With 'Far Cry 4,' Ubisoft made the decision to announce the game in a manner designed to get some buzz going ahead of a proper reveal, which followed at E3. And the game did get buzz, but it wasn't all good as the mere appearance of the box art was enough to incite an loud backlash. Fortunately, with a series of reveals of the actually gameplay and story footage, not to mention details involving the co-op, the buzz shafted back to the game.
The entire "play co-op with one version of the game on PlayStation platforms" alone was enough to ignite a positive buzz. The game's opening five minutes is compelling as well. Ultimately, the game did so well at E3 that Ubisoft decided that it needed a new montage.
